UK Family Visas

UK Family Visas

UK Family Visas allow individuals to join their family members who are either British citizens, settled in the UK, refugees, or have humanitarian protection. These visas enable family members to live together in the UK and, in many cases, offer a pathway to settlement and eventually British citizenship. There are several types of Family Visas, each catering to different familial relationships, such as spouses, children, parents, and other relatives.

Key Features

  • Pathway to Settlement: Many Family Visas lead to indefinite leave to remain (ILR) and, eventually, British citizenship.
  • Work and Study Rights: Most Family Visa holders have the right to work and study in the UK.
  • Health Surcharge: Applicants must pay the Immigration Health Surcharge (IHS) as part of the visa application process, granting access to the UK’s National Health Service (NHS).

Eligibility Criteria

General Requirements:
  • Relationship Proof: Applicants must demonstrate a genuine and subsisting relationship with the UK-based family member.
  • Financial Requirements: Sponsors must meet minimum income thresholds to support the applicant without recourse to public funds.
  • Accommodation: Proof of adequate accommodation for the applicant in the UK.
  • English Language Proficiency: Applicants may need to prove their knowledge of English through an approved test or qualification.
Specific Requirements:
  • Spouse/Partner Visa: Must prove the relationship is genuine and meet financial and accommodation requirements.
  • Fiancé(e) Visa: Must prove the intention to marry within six months and meet financial and relationship requirements.
  • Child Visa: The child must be under 18 and dependent on the UK-based parent(s).
  • Parent Visa: The parent must have sole or shared responsibility for the child in the UK.
  • Adult Dependent Relative Visa: Must prove the need for long-term care that cannot be provided in the home country.

Required Documents

  1. Valid Passport: A valid passport or travel document.
  2. Proof of Relationship: Marriage certificate, birth certificate, or other documents proving the relationship.
  3. Financial Evidence: Bank statements, payslips, or other financial documents showing the sponsor meets the income threshold.
  4. English Language Test Results: Proof of English proficiency if required.
  5. Accommodation Details: Documents showing adequate accommodation in the UK.
  6. Other Supporting Documents: Additional documents may be required depending on the specific visa type.

Application Process

  1. Determine Eligibility: Ensure you meet the eligibility requirements for the specific Family Visa category.
  2. Prepare Documents: Gather all required documents, including proof of relationship, financial evidence, and English language proficiency.
  3. Online Application: Complete the Family Visa application form online via the UK government website.
  4. Pay Fees: Pay the visa application fee and Immigration Health Surcharge (IHS).
  5. Biometric Appointment: Book and attend an appointment to provide biometric information (fingerprints and photograph).
  6. Submit Application: Submit your application and all supporting documents.
  7. Decision: Wait for a decision, which can take several weeks depending on the complexity of the case.

Cost

CategoryCost
Spouse/Partner Visa (outside UK)£1,538
Spouse/Partner Visa (inside UK)£1,048
Fiancé(e) Visa£1,538
Child Visa£1,538 (per child)
Parent Visa£1,538
Adult Dependent Relative Visa£3,250
Immigration Health Surcharge (IHS)£624 per year
Biometric Fee£19.20

Note: Costs may vary depending on specific circumstances and location.

Visa Processing Time

Application TypeProcessing Time
Standard Application12 weeks (outside the UK)
Priority Service5 working days (additional cost)
Super Priority ServiceNext working day (additional cost)

Note: Processing times are approximate and may vary depending on the complexity of the case.
